Bird fancier's lung (BFL) is a form of hypersensitivity pneumonitis. It can also be called a bird breeder's lung.

It can result in weariness, anorexia, weight loss, chest pain, fever, a dry cough, shortness of breath, and progressive pulmonary fibrosis (the most serious complication). It is brought on by exposure to avian proteins found in dry dust from bird droppings or feathers of different species.

Granuloma development occurs along with lung inflammation. People who possess a lot of birds or deal with birds are most affected.

Based on symptoms and how they worsen after exposure to avian proteins, BFL can be diagnosed. Radiology can reveal lung damage, which has a distinctive "ground glass" appearance.

Prednisone or other steroid medications may be used to treat BFL in order to minimize inflammation and prevent future exposure to avian proteins. Treatments are frequently highly successful if pulmonary fibrosis has not developed.

Any bird can produce these antigens. BFL could be brought on by pigeon allergies.

Other birds, such as parakeets, cockatiels, budgerigars, parrots, turtledoves, turkeys, chickens, and other birds, may also contain allergens. Feathers used in the bedding might potentially contain antigens.

People who own or work with birds are at risk, as are bird lovers and pet store employees. The only long-term remedy advised is to stay away from avian proteins, which cause BFL.

In severe situations, patients might be advised to permanently leave their homes and get rid of any possessions that have been exposed to avian proteins if they can't be cleaned thoroughly both inside and out. Any infected goods shouldn't be cleaned by the patient.

Before interacting with the patient, anyone who has touched objects that have been around birds should change into clean clothes and wash their hair.

It is advised to remove all birds, feather-filled clothing, and sleeping bags, as well as any bedding and pillows, from the patient's residence. In order to prevent future exposure to birds, bird droppings, or anything containing feathers, such as pillows in many hotels, it is also important to wash any soft furnishings, walls, ceilings, and furniture.
